Have you noticed a huge difference in front grip with the various camber settings that you have ran on the car? I mean, is it dramatic as you approach -2.0 or beyond?

I still get some push with -1.5 degrees while autocrossing, but still need to go back to a big track to see how the car feels in a faster situation. I am maxed out with the pins pulled, so I would really have to put in some effort or $$ to get any more negative camber.
So far yes. Each increase in negative camber has resulted in more grip, less understeer and quicker lap times. I first started with stock camber (-1.2), then pulled pins and added more camber (-1.6), then installed plates and increased camber (-2.1). And now, increased camber to -2.5.
